§14–305.
A person may not drill, bore, drive, dig, or otherwise conduct any operation for the purpose of obtaining access to a pocket or other underground area for the purpose of storing natural or artificial gas or petroleum products and their derivatives, unless a permit for the operation, construction, and storage has been first obtained from the Department. Nothing in this subtitle shall be construed to apply to the installation or maintenance of underground tanks or vessels commonly used to store these products.
